We have a requirement like the following:
We are developing a portal application. We need to access that through Intranet as well as through Internet.
The problem is that, for Internet (logged in as anonymous user), the look and feel and navigation of the pages are very different from that of Intranet, but the content is the same for both Intranet and Internet. Basically, the JSP templates are different for Internet and Intranet.
Do we need to deploy different applications  to make this happen? Can we customize the navigation menu and look and feel diffently for Internet and Intranet from the same application?
Please suggest any ideas if you have.
Kind regards,
Sreejesh.

Hi Sreejesh,
if you have different JSP templates, it's up to you to create different applications (for different users? roles?! how to differentiate?) or to make the usage of the JSPs of the application itself flexible (so that the application decides at runtime which template will be used).
> Can we customize the navigation menu
In general you can customize the look and feel of the portal: System Administration -- Portal Display -- Theme Editor.
If you want to modify more than colors etc, you should consider using the LightFrameworkPage together with a sef-developed DetNav using the Navigation TagLib, see http://help.sap.com/saphelp_nw04/helpdata/en/42/ea3a29b28e1bcae10000000a11466f/frameset.htm

  • How to monitor if portal access through browser is down

    I would like to catch the alert before users report Web site not
    accessible(HTTP 404). I'm thinking of an unix cron job. But what
    should I querry to check the status of Portal?

    In case you are still looking for responses to your question --
    We've been using a product called "WhatsUp Gold" from Ipswitch
    Inc. (http://www.ipswitch.com/products/whatsup/) to do
    monitoring like this for the past few weeks, and so far it's
    worked very well. I put a few simple "monitoring" pages on our
    web servers to return the status of each of the services, then
    we poll these pages every 60 seconds. If we don't get the
    expected response back from any of these queries, WhatsUp sends
    out emails and pages telling us what machine and what service is
    down.
    So far I'm polling the basic HTML service, the database
    connection (mod_plsql), the servlet service, JSP, and am working
    on a way to poll our report server engines and cluster
    machines. (I took the "poll exactly one and only one service at
    a time" approach so whenever something crashes (usually no more
    than once or twice a day... <sigh>), I know exactly what piece
    went down.)

  • Access to the time capsule harddrive through internet.

    Hi everyone,
    I bought a few months ago a Time capsule and it is working perfeclty as a network and hard drive under. It is connected to the router unde a  bridge mode.
    My prooblem is coming when I want to access through internet with my Macbook  to my time capsule as it is not possible but according the time capsule specification it is possible to have acces to the harddrive through internet. So it means I have to change soemthing in the setp up on the router (P-2812HNU-F1) or in the time capsule.
    Can anyone help me to set up the time capsule and the router  accordingly to be able to have acces to the harddrivethrough internet? 
    Thanks

    Have you tried using BTMM and iCloud method?
    That is the only method Apple provisioned on the TC and apple network.
    http://www.apple.com/au/support/icloud/back-to-my-mac/
    If you are having issues you need to tell us more..
    Sometimes it seems the TC in bridge will not work.. if that is the case, then you must see if you can rearrange your network so the TC is the main router.
    Or you need to use a manual access method.
    This requires using a static public IP (Check with your ISP.. this is by far the best method) or use a dyndns service.. and port forward 548 TCP to the TC.. there are thousands of posts and youtube videos with the info. Just look up "remote access time capsule"
    This is a good post to start with.

  • CIC WebClient through Internet

    Hi group
    Can the CIC WebClient be accessed through internet? If yes , why and if no, why not?
    Waiting for your early reply
    Thanks and regards
    Debolina

    Yes you can Access WebClient through Internet using ITS
    You should have Installed the Internet Transaction Server (ITS) to provide access to the local SAP CRM system or to another SAP R/3 system with CRM plug-ins
    For more information about the SAP ITS, see the SAP Help Portal (help.sap.com) under SAP NetWeaver ® SAP Web Application Server ®  SAP NetWeaver Components ® ITS / SAP@Web Studio (BC-FES-ITS)
    You can access it through Internet if you have..
    Started the ITS
    Noted the URL of the ITS
    Defined your logical systems using transaction BD54
    Defined your Remote Function Call (RFC) destinations using transaction SM59
    Assigned RFC destinations to logical systems using transaction BD97
    Procedure
                From the SAP Easy Access menu, choose Interaction Center ® Interaction Center WebClient ® Administration ® System Parameters ® Define Transaction Launcher Logical Systems and URLs.
